Solution for 7+14y-6=9y+29-2y equation:


Simplifying
7 + 14y + -6 = 9y + 29 + -2y

Reorder the terms:
7 + -6 + 14y = 9y + 29 + -2y

Combine like terms: 7 + -6 = 1
1 + 14y = 9y + 29 + -2y

Reorder the terms:
1 + 14y = 29 + 9y + -2y

Combine like terms: 9y + -2y = 7y
1 + 14y = 29 + 7y

Solving
1 + 14y = 29 + 7y

Solving for variable 'y'.

Move all terms containing y to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-7y' to each side of the equation.
1 + 14y + -7y = 29 + 7y + -7y

Combine like terms: 14y + -7y = 7y
1 + 7y = 29 + 7y + -7y

Combine like terms: 7y + -7y = 0
1 + 7y = 29 + 0
1 + 7y = 29

Add '-1' to each side of the equation.
1 + -1 + 7y = 29 + -1

Combine like terms: 1 + -1 = 0
0 + 7y = 29 + -1
7y = 29 + -1

Combine like terms: 29 + -1 = 28
7y = 28

Divide each side by '7'.
y = 4

Simplifying
y = 4
